Is brown rice good for babies?
Whole grain brown rice isn't just a healthy choice for grownups. It offers nutritional benefits for babies, too. “Nutrients found in brown rice include healthy carbohydrates, protein, fiber, B vitamins, manganese, selenium, magnesium, as well as antioxidants,” says Chow.Can I give my baby brown rice?
Brown rice that is prepared at home is the safest option to give to your baby. Most people recommend introducing your baby to solid food items only after they turn 6 months old. Hence you can start giving brown rice to your little one once he turns 6 months old.Which kind of rice is good for babies?
Brown rice is hands down the best rice for your baby. It is loaded with B3, B1, B6, Manganese, Selenium, Magnesium, fiber and essential fatty acids.Is brown rice constipating for babies?
Fiber foods.Anything containing bran (known for its high fiber content) could help loosen up your baby's stool. Look for fiber-rich cereals, whole-wheat pasta, and brown rice.

Should babies have white or brown rice?
Whether in the form of cereal, soup, balls, or plain grains, brown rice will add fiber, protein, and micronutrients to your child's diet. Help them develop a taste for whole grains by serving brown rather than white rice as often as possible.Can brown rice cause constipation?
There is a big difference between white rice and brown rice. White rice can lead to constipation because the husk, bran, and germ have been removed. That's where all the fiber and nutrients are! Brown rice can help relieve constipation because the husk, bran, and germ have not been removed.Can a 9 month old eat brown rice?

Brown rice has 80 percent more inorganic arsenic on average than white rice of the same type. Arsenic accumulates in the grain's outer layers, which are removed to make white rice. Brown has more nutrients, though, so you shouldn't switch entirely to white.Which Dal is good for babies?

Brown rice contains antinutrients
- Antinutrients are plant compounds that may reduce your body's ability to absorb certain nutrients. ...
- While phytic acid may offer some health benefits, it also reduces your body's ability to absorb iron and zinc from food. ...
- Brown rice tends to be higher in arsenic than white rice ( 2 1 ).
